BBC pundit John Beattie says England will never win the Rugby World Cup again unless they play their season in summer. Southern hemisphere teams such as South Africa, New Zealand and Australia play their seasons throughout the summer months, compared to the north's winter schedule. The former Scottish International said: "There's only been one Northern Hemisphere success at the World Cup, which was England in 2003, a wet World Cup. The southern hemisphere teams naturally play in dryer conditions, and are more conditioned to chucking the ball around." "Until England get summer rugby, they'll never win the World Cup again because these teams are miles ahead, and better conditioned". This clip first appeared on 5 live Sport, 12th October 2015.
